## Tuning cache invalidation

The Pantryline catalog cache is deliberately aggressive — product pages are read-heavy and prices rarely change mid-day. If you're seeing stale SKUs, don't just crank the TTL down; check the invalidation fanout first, since that's bitten us twice. The defaults that survived load testing are listed below:

tuning table, faweg-bajep:
WEIGHTS = {
    "belius": 690,
    "eliox": 458,
    "norax": 616,
    "praion": 132,
    "zorvan": 911,
}

14:22 — Offline sync regression confirmed (Terrapath field-survey app)

At 14:22 the on-call engineer reproduced the data-loss path: surveys saved while offline were marked synced once connectivity returned, even when the upload was rejected. The queue flush skipped the server acknowledgement check introduced in the previous sprint. Release manager note: the fix must ship before the coastal survey season. The offending build is identified by the token recorded below.

session token of kawif-fawig = htk31_f3f599be2b1a34affb1efa8d0feccf8

To: Finance Team

The Bramblepoint loyalty scheme is being restructured from the next quarter. Points accrual moves from flat-rate to tiered, and redemption liability will now be provisioned monthly instead of annually. Finance should expect a one-off adjustment when the old balances are revalued under the new terms. Please update the accrual models and circulate revised guidance to branch controllers before month-end close. Questions go to the programme office. The related confidential note on business plans follows directly below.

management briefing: Only 3 of the 140 pilot accounts renewed Oliix, so a churn review is set for July 1.

## Idempotency Keys for Payment Retries (Lumopay)

Every retry of a charge request must reuse the original idempotency key; generating a new key on retry can produce duplicate charges. Keys are scoped per merchant and expire after 48 hours. Reviewers should verify keys are derived server-side, never from client input. The full key-generation specification and threat model are maintained on the internal page.

dashboard of kaguf-tawip = https://vault.merlaqsys.test/issue